Is There A Problem With Lighting Gardens Up At Night?

Answer Question

1 Answer - Sort by: Date | Rating

    Yes and no. Energy conservation is really important now the negative impacts of global warming are more widely accepted. Using fossil fuels to light up gardens just for the pleasure of seeing them at night is perhaps one of the most wasteful uses of energy. However, it is possible to install solar powered lighting that absorbs energy from the sun during the day and transform this into bulb power at night. They are usually not as powerful as normal lights but a lot better for the planet. One of the good things about lighting the garden is that it can actually attract wildlife. Insects will be attracted to the light and this may lead to bats discovering your garden as a good source of food. This should be balanced against the concern some people have about light pollution. Street lighting and increased use of lighting in domestic settings designed to deter crime means that few of us ever see the true night sky or experience real darkness. There are worries that birds are being negatively affected in some urban areas as the constant light disrupts their roosting habits.
